China Reiterates Rejection of South China Sea Arbitration on Anniversary

China Reiterates Rejection of South China Sea Arbitration on Anniversary

12 Temmuz 2026Bloomberg
  • China has once again rejected the South China Sea arbitration ruling, which was issued a decade ago, reaffirming its stance against the decision. The Chinese government also criticized a joint statement released by the United States and its allies that commemorated the anniversary of the ruling.
  • This rejection highlights ongoing tensions in the region regarding territorial claims and maritime rights.
  • The South China Sea arbitration ruling, issued by an international tribunal in 2016, invalidated China's extensive claims in the region, which has been a point of contention for years.
